Scope and content

Snapshots taken around the time of the opening of the Botany Building in 1932. There is one view of the procession and several views of professors and dignitaries visiting the Ontario Agricultural College in Guelph and surrounding area. Identified is Professors A.C. Seward of the Botany School at Cambridge University who visited the University of Toronto for the opening. He was accompanied by Prof. A.P. Coleman, H.S. Jackson of Botany, J.E. Howitt of Guelph as well other botanists presumably from Guelph. There are also numerous views of "pot hole" formations at Elora taken presumably around the same time.
